Job Description:

The Wing Loads and Aeroelastics team in Bristol (UK) is looking for talented individuals to join a highly engaged and international team of experts, specialists and integrators as a Wing Loads and Aeroelastics Engineer.

You will be working closely with the departments of Flight Physics and Airframe in order to calculate and analyse external wing loads for all major Airbus programmes, including the A320 family and the A350XWB. You will be involved from the very beginning of the process (first concepts and preliminary design) through to end product certification.

The team is situated at the interface between many different engineering disciplines and works across many different projects, including the very latest research and technology projects focusing on sustainability and zero emissions. Tasks & Accountabilities:

  • Establish requirements for Finite Element Model (FEM) loading and wing airframe design and ensure the overall aircraft loads calculation process is shaped to meet these requirements.

  • Calculate, interpret and deliver static and fatigue external loads acting on the wing components in adherence with the relevant airworthiness regulations, quality processes and programme assumptions.

  • Support the wing airframe design teams in their use of this data.

  • Support flight test campaigns to validate load calculations.

  • Acquire competencies related to new technologies, for example, data analytics, Model Based Systems Engineering, Artificial Intelligence etc.

  • Continuously improve quality, processes, methods and tools.

  • Ensure a positive relationship and team spirit is maintained within the team and with all stakeholders.

As your knowledge and experience grows, you will be relied upon to contribute to aircraft optimisation and identify and manage technical risk through innovative, multidisciplinary approaches.
